Sustainable development has been the most significant and irreversible trend in the packaging container market in recent years. It is worth noting, however, that the market’s definition of ‘green’ has evolved from an early, one-dimensional approach towards a more systematic way of thinking.
The profound evolution of material substitution: the traditional approach of ‘replacing plastic with paper’ continues, but its scope has expanded significantly. In addition to FSC-certified paper and cardboard, bio-based materials and recycled agricultural waste are moving from the laboratory towards large-scale application. At the same time, single-material design has become the mainstream approach, aimed at addressing the challenge of recycling multi-layer composite materials. For example, many food and beverage packaging products are shifting from PET/PE composite structures to all-PE or all-PP structures in order to improve recycling rates.
The Mandatory Use of Recycled Materials and the Supply Dilemma: With the implementation of policies in the EU and China, brands are required to use a certain proportion of recycled plastic in new packaging. This has led to a shortage of food-grade recycled resin, with prices at one point exceeding those of virgin material. The market focus has shifted from ‘whether to use recycled materials’ to ‘how to ensure a stable supply of high-quality recycled materials’, spurring a surge in investment in chemical recycling technologies to overcome the limitations of mechanical recycling in terms of purity and performance. The relentless pursuit of material reduction and lightweight design: It has become an industry consensus to reduce material usage through structural optimisation and process improvements, whilst ensuring barrier properties and mechanical strength. For example, the weight of beverage preforms continues to decrease, and the thickness of flexible packaging films is constantly being reduced. This not only lowers carbon emissions but also directly hedges against the risk of raw material price fluctuations.
Exploring the circular economy model: the role of packaging containers is shifting from ‘linear consumption’ to ‘circular reuse’. In the B2B sector, standardised returnable crates and pallet pool sharing schemes are becoming increasingly established; in the B2C sector, refillable packaging systems are being piloted in the personal care, household cleaning and certain food and beverage sectors. Although these face challenges relating to consumer habits and reverse logistics costs, they represent the way forward.
Drastic changes in consumers’ lifestyles—particularly the ‘stay-at-home economy’ following the pandemic, growing health awareness and the rise of on-demand retail—have compelled packaging to evolve rapidly in terms of both functionality and user experience.
Resilient packaging suited to e-commerce and on-demand retail: As the share of online channels continues to rise, packaging must withstand increasingly complex logistics processes. Compression resistance, shock resistance and leak-proofing have become fundamental requirements. At the same time, to adapt to instant retail scenarios such as front-end distribution centres and food delivery, packaging is trending towards smaller sizes, portability and easy-to-open designs. For example, packaging for ready-to-cook meals emphasises a balance between microwave suitability and airtight freshness retention, whilst packaging for fresh produce prioritises modified atmosphere preservation and anti-fogging functions.
The prominence of health and safety attributes: In the post-pandemic era, consumer concern for hygiene and safety has reached unprecedented levels. Safety features such as antimicrobial coatings, self-disinfecting materials, single-use sealing strips and tamper-evident designs are being widely incorporated. At the same time, the ‘clean label’ trend has extended to the packaging sector, with features such as BPA-free, no mineral oil migration and low odour becoming standard in high-end packaging.
Emotional Connection and Personalised Expression: Gen Z consumers view packaging as an extension of a brand’s values and their own identity. Packaging design now places greater emphasis on aesthetics, playfulness and social appeal. Limited editions, collaborative designs and blind-box-style packaging are emerging in ever-greater numbers; sensory experience technologies such as tactile textures, thermochromic inks and AR interactions are being utilised to enhance the ritual of unboxing. Packaging is no longer a silent element; it has become the primary medium through which brands engage with consumers.
The Return of Age-Friendly and Inclusive Design: In the face of an ageing society, packaging designs that are easy to grip and open, feature clear typography and high colour contrast are once again being prioritised. This is not only a matter of social responsibility, but also a practical step towards tapping into the silver economy.
Digital technology is becoming deeply embedded in the entire life cycle of packaging containers, transforming them from static objects into dynamic data nodes.
The widespread adoption of smart labels and traceability systems: falling costs of technologies such as QR codes, NFC and RFID have made ‘one product, one code’ a reality. Consumers can simply scan the code to access information such as product traceability, authenticity verification, nutritional content and recycling guidelines; brands, in turn, utilise this to build their own private traffic channels, gather consumer insights and combat unauthorised distribution and counterfeit goods. In the B2B sector, RFID tags enable automated stock-taking and end-to-end temperature-controlled monitoring in warehousing and logistics.
Digital printing enables flexible production: by breaking down the high barriers to entry associated with traditional plate-making and printing, digital printing technology makes customised packaging—characterised by small batches, multiple SKUs and rapid job changes—an economically viable option. This greatly supports new brands in testing the market, regional marketing and seasonal campaigns, whilst shortening time-to-market.
AI-driven packaging design and inspection: Generative AI is now assisting with packaging structure design, pattern creation and material selection, accelerating the pace of innovation and iteration. On the production side, machine vision-based AI quality inspection systems are replacing manual labour, enabling millisecond-level precision in the detection of printing defects, foreign objects and poor seals, thereby significantly improving yield rates and production efficiency.
Blockchain enhances supply chain transparency: in sectors such as premium food and pharmaceuticals, blockchain technology is used to record tamper-proof data—including the origin of packaging materials, production processes and logistics trajectories—thereby providing credible endorsement for sustainability claims and safety assurances, and addressing the trust requirements of both regulators and consumers.
